Question

solve the following exponential equation. express the solution in terms of natural logarithms or common logarithms. then, use a calculator to obtain a decimal approximation for the solution.
7^{2x + 3} = 3^{x - 4}
the solution set expressed in terms of logarithms is
(use a comma to separate answers as needed. simplify your answer. use integers or fractions for any numbers in the expression. use ln for natural logarithm and log for common logarithm)

Explanation:

Step1: Take log on both sides

Take the natural logarithm (ln) of both sides of the equation \(7^{2x + 3}=3^{x - 4}\). We get \(\ln(7^{2x + 3})=\ln(3^{x - 4})\).

Step2: Apply log power rule

Using the power rule of logarithms \(\ln(a^b)=b\ln(a)\), we can rewrite the equation as \((2x + 3)\ln(7)=(x - 4)\ln(3)\).

Step3: Expand both sides

Expand the left - hand side and the right - hand side: \(2x\ln(7)+3\ln(7)=x\ln(3)-4\ln(3)\).

Step4: Collect x terms

Move all terms with \(x\) to one side and the constant terms to the other side. Subtract \(x\ln(3)\) from both sides and subtract \(3\ln(7)\) from both sides: \(2x\ln(7)-x\ln(3)=- 4\ln(3)-3\ln(7)\).

Step5: Factor out x

Factor out \(x\) from the left - hand side: \(x(2\ln(7)-\ln(3))=-4\ln(3)-3\ln(7)\).

Step6: Solve for x

Divide both sides by \((2\ln(7)-\ln(3))\) to solve for \(x\): \(x=\frac{-4\ln(3)-3\ln(7)}{2\ln(7)-\ln(3)}\) or we can factor out the negative sign from the numerator: \(x=\frac{-(4\ln(3)+3\ln(7))}{2\ln(7)-\ln(3)}=\frac{4\ln(3)+3\ln(7)}{\ln(3)-2\ln(7)}\) (by multiplying numerator and denominator by - 1)

Answer:

\(x = \frac{-4\ln(3)-3\ln(7)}{2\ln(7)-\ln(3)}\) (or equivalent form \(\frac{4\ln(3)+3\ln(7)}{\ln(3)-2\ln(7)}\))
